Spotlight on ONCAT research


October 21, 2025
thumbnail

In ONCAT’s newest report — “What the 2024 University/College Applicant Study Tells Us About Transfer” — Jeffrey Napierala draws on survey responses from 41,351 applicants to 21 Ontario postsecondary institutions.


The report highlights key insights about ways that students make decisions related to their postsecondary education.

The University/College Applicant Study (UCAS) is an annual survey conducted by the Academica Group that gathers data about applicants to postsecondary institutions across Canada. For the past two years, ONCAT has partnered with Academica to expand the survey’s consideration of student mobility and transfer experiences in Ontario. This partnership introduced new questions focused on students’ educational backgrounds, reasons for transferring and overall expectations.
